Shadowsocks与VPN的区别详解

在当今的互联网环境中,保护个人隐私和数据安全显得尤为重要。尤其是在中国等网络监管较严格的地区,许多人开始使用网络代理工具来突破网络限制。在众多代理工具中,ShadowsocksVPN是最受欢迎的两种选择。那么,它们之间到底有什么区别呢?

1. 什么是Shadowsocks?

Shadowsocks是一种基于SOCKS5协议的代理工具,它允许用户通过中间服务器转发网络流量,从而实现翻墙的目的。Shadowsocks的主要特征是轻量级、高性能、易于配置。它的设计目的是为了绕过网络审查,适合在需要翻墙的环境中使用。

Shadowsocks的优点

  • 速度快:由于Shadowsocks采用的是轻量级的加密,延迟较低,速度相对较快。
  • 易于部署:用户可以在自己的服务器上搭建Shadowsocks,简单易行。
  • 灵活性:支持多种加密方式,用户可以根据需要选择不同的加密方案。

2. 什么是VPN?

VPN(虚拟私人网络)是一种通过加密协议将用户的设备与互联网连接起来的技术。VPN会将用户的网络流量经过VPN服务器进行加密处理,从而保护用户的隐私。用户在使用VPN时,所有的流量都会经过VPN服务器,确保了数据的安全。

VPN的优点

  • 安全性高:VPN提供全面的数据加密,保护用户的信息不被窃取。
  • 全局访问:用户可以访问全球的所有网站,绕过地区限制。
  • 隐私保护:VPN隐藏了用户的真实IP地址,提高了匿名性。

3. Shadowsocks与VPN的主要区别

在了解了Shadowsocks和VPN的基本概念后,接下来我们将重点分析它们之间的区别。

3.1 工作原理

  • Shadowsocks:使用的是SOCKS5协议,用户可以自定义代理设置,允许部分应用使用代理,灵活性高。
  • VPN:使用的是隧道协议(如OpenVPN、L2TP等),所有的流量都会通过VPN服务器,不能选择性代理。

3.2 安全性

  • Shadowsocks:虽然提供一定的加密,但其安全性相对VPN较低,容易被深度包检测(DPI)识别。
  • VPN:通过强加密算法(如AES-256),提供更高的安全保障,适合传输敏感数据。

3.3 速度与性能

  • Shadowsocks:因其轻量级的特性,通常在速度上优于VPN,适合观看视频或下载大文件。
  • VPN:速度可能受到服务器负载和加密强度的影响,尤其在使用高强度加密时,速度会有所下降。

3.4 使用场景

  • Shadowsocks:适合技术用户,能够自建服务器的用户,或在不需要极高安全性的情况下使用。
  • VPN:适合对安全性有较高要求的用户,尤其是需要保护敏感信息的用户。

4. Shadowsocks和VPN的适用场景

  • Shadowsocks:适合在不需要完全隐私保护的情况下,如翻墙浏览社交媒体、观看视频等。
  • VPN:适合需要强隐私保护的场合,如金融交易、网上购物或处理敏感文件时。

5. 如何选择Shadowsocks或VPN?

选择Shadowsocks还是VPN主要取决于个人需求:

  • 如果您主要关注速度和灵活性,可以考虑Shadowsocks。
  • 如果您更重视安全和隐私保护,则VPN会是更好的选择。

6. 常见问题解答

6.1 Shadowsocks和VPN哪个更安全?

  • VPN提供更强的加密和隐私保护,而Shadowsocks相对较弱,适合不同的需求场景。

6.2 使用Shadowsocks会泄露IP地址吗?

  • 在使用不当的情况下,Shadowsocks可能会泄露真实IP地址,因此需要配置正确的规则来保护隐私。

6.3 Shadowsocks和VPN能否一起使用?

  • 是的,可以在使用VPN的同时配置Shadowsocks,利用两者的优点,提高网络安全性和速度。

6.4 在中国使用Shadowsocks和VPN哪个更好?

  • VPN由于全面的加密和隐私保护,在中国网络环境下表现相对更好,但Shadowsocks在突破网络封锁时可能速度更快。

结论

总体而言,ShadowsocksVPN各有优缺点,适合不同的用户需求。在选择时,用户需要根据自己的具体情况,权衡安全性、速度和灵活性,做出明智的选择。希望本文能帮助您更好地理解这两种网络代理工具的区别。

正文完